Transponder Keys
Many of the newer audi key shell models are equipped with a key fob which incorporates a transponder chip that can transmit an identification signal once it is inserted into the ignition. This technology has significantly reduced the risk of theft from your vehicle and is an excellent way to ensure your vehicle is secure. However, just like any other electronic device, they are not immune to failure. In some cases physical damage or malfunctioning chip may require a new device.
Thankfully, replacing a lost or damaged Audi transponder key is an easy process when you hire the right locksmith. A reliable locksmith can cut and program a brand new car key for your car on the spot. This is much easier and less expensive than waiting for the dealer to make the key.

In the early 1990s, audi keys replacement began introducing transponder keys on their cars. These keys have a microchip embedded in the head of the key that transmits unique signals when they are inserted into your car's ignition. The signal is then read by the vehicle's computer and if the data is compatible, it will allow the engine to begin.
The benefit of this technology is that the transponder's algorithm is constantly changing which makes it harder to hack or duplicate. This technology has drastically reduced the rate of car thefts, particularly for luxury cars that are expensive.

Key Fobs
Most modern cars come with fobs with keys that allow you to open and start the vehicle. Fobs come with proximity sensors that communicate with the car to activate its systems. The sensor on the key fob sends out a signal identifying you as the owner. The immobiliser chip is activated so you can start the car. If you lose your Audi key it is impossible to get back in or start the car without the replacement.
These keys are more complex than traditional keys made of metal. They need to be programmed to function with your vehicle. This can only be done by a dealer or locksmith with the appropriate equipment to program the latest models of cars.
The price of a fob is typically higher than a traditional metal key. This is due to the fact that it is usually built with more advanced features and requires more technology to perform. It could be costly to replace the fob in case it is damaged or lost.

Smart Keys
Audi's new smart key technology has elevated car keys to a new level. These wireless keys, unlike traditional metal key fobs are equipped with proximity sensors that allow drivers to lock and unlock their cars without having to touch a button. This is a huge benefit for drivers with mobility issues, children, and any other person who has difficulty reaching traditional keys for their vehicle.
These Audi smart keys aren't just convenient, they also come with security features to protect them from thieves with a high-tech edge. While standard key fobs broadcast the exact frequency signal each time a driver opens or locks their doors smart keys broadcast encrypted signals that are specific to each door and trunk. This helps prevent theft by making it difficult for thieves to figure out the code and take over the vehicle, according to Open Road Auto Group.
Smart keys can also be used to start a car when they're not in the ignition. This feature is helpful when you are loading groceries, children or other large items into your vehicle, or when you are wearing gloves and don't want to take off your gloves to access your keys.
